网站首页 网站地图
网站首页 > 娱乐人生 > 数控g1锥度编程怎么编

数控g1锥度编程怎么编

时间:2026-03-20 03:14:27

数控G1锥度编程通常涉及以下步骤和代码:

设置坐标系和起始点

```

G00 G90 G54 X0 Y0 ; 设置绝对坐标系并移动到起始点S2000

```

启动主轴

```

M03 ; 启动主轴正转

```

定位刀具

```

G43 H01 Z50 ; 定位刀具,并在Z轴上设定刀具长度偏移为50mm

```

快速下刀到起切点

```

G01 Z-20 F200 ; 快速下刀到起切点

```

直线插补到加工起点

```

G01 X100 Y100 F100 ; 直线插补刀具到加工起点

```

圆弧插补画出锥面

```

G03 X0 Y0 R100 ; 以半径为100的圆弧插补画出锥面

```

直线插补到加工终点

```

G01 X200 Y200 F100 ; 直线插补刀具到加工终点

```

快速抬刀

```

G01 Z-50 ; 快速抬刀

```

停止主轴

```

M05 ; 停止主轴

```

程序结束

```

M30 ; 程序结束

```

示例代码

```

G00 G90 G54 X0 Y0 ; 设置绝对坐标系并移动到起始点S2000

M03 ; 启动主轴正转

G43 H01 Z50 ; 定位刀具,并在Z轴上设定刀具长度偏移为50mm

G01 Z-20 F200 ; 快速下刀到起切点

G01 X100 Y100 F100 ; 直线插补刀具到加工起点

G03 X0 Y0 R100 ; 以半径为100的圆弧插补画出锥面

G01 X200 Y200 F100 ; 直线插补刀具到加工终点

G01 Z-50 ; 快速抬刀

M05 ; 停止主轴

M30 ; 程序结束

```

注意事项

刀具半径补偿:

如果使用刀具半径补偿,可以使用G40指令。

切削参数:

根据具体加工要求设定进给速度(F)和主轴转速(S)。

锥度编程指令:

除了G1指令外,还可以使用G2、G3、G71等指令来实现不同形式的锥度加工。

通过以上步骤和代码,可以实现数控G1锥度的精确编程。建议在实际应用中根据具体加工需求和机床特性进行调整和优化。